Slimme thermostaat aansturen via een Raspberry Pi met Zigbee2MQTT
Je kent het wel: je komt thuis en het huis is koud, of je vergeet de verwarming lager te draaien voordat je naar bed gaat. Met een slimme thermostaat los je dat op, maar het echte goud zit ‘m in de combinatie met een Raspberry Pi en Zigbee2MQTT. Dit stukje techniek geeft je volledige controle, zonder dat je vastzit aan een duur abonnement of een gesloten systeem. Je bouwt je eigen energiecentrale, precies afgestemd op jouw zonnepanelen, laadpaal en comfort.
Wat is een slimme thermostaat aansturen via Raspberry Pi en Zigbee2MQTT?
Stel je voor: je hebt een Raspberry Pi, een minicomputer ter grootte van een creditcard, en je sluit er een Zigbee-coordinator op aan. Dat is een klein usb-stickje dat draadloos communiceert met je slimme apparaten.
Met de software Zigbee2MQTT vertaal je die signalen naar berichten die je Pi makkelijk begrijpt.
Je slimme thermostaat, zoals de Aqara Smart Thermostat of de Tuya Zigbee Thermostat, wordt daarmee een onderdeel van je eigen netwerk, zonder tussenkomst van de cloud. De kern is eenvoudig: je Pi ontvangt data over de kamertemperatuur, de gewenste stand en de status van je cv-ketel of warmtepomp. Via MQTT, een lichtgewicht berichtensysteem, stuur je commando’s terug.
Je kunt regels bouwen die rekening houden met je zonnepanelen, de stroomprijzen van je energieleverancier en zelfs je laadpaal. Zo bespaar je energie zonder in te leveren op comfort.
Waarom is deze opzet zo waardevol?
Een standaard slimme thermostaat doet zijn werk, maar je zit vaak vast aan de app van één merk.
Die app bepaalt wat je kunt instellen en hoe je data wordt gebruikt. Met een Raspberry Pi en Zigbee2MQTT neem je de regie over. Je kunt je thermostaat koppelen aan je zonnepanelen, zodat je verwarming iets harder gaat als de zon volop schijnt en de stroom gratis is.
Dit is ook een stuk privacyvriendelijker. Je data blijft in je eigen netwerk, niet op een server in de cloud.
Bovendien kun je flink besparen op je energierekening. Door je thermostaat slim te laten reageren op de dynamische stroomprijzen van je energieleverancier, zoals bijvoorbeeld bij Tibber of ANWB Energie, stook je vooral als het goedkoop is.
Dat kan zomaar tientallen euro’s per maand schelen.
Hoe bouw je het? Een praktische stappenplan
Begin met de hardware. Een Raspberry Pi 4 of 5 met 4 GB RAM is ruim voldoende.
Daarop sluit je een Zigbee-coordinator aan, zoals de Sonoff Zigbee 3.0 USB Dongle Plus (€25-€30) of de ConBee II (€50-€55). Deze stickjes zorgen voor een stabiele verbinding met je Zigbee-apparaten. Zorg dat je Pi een vaste plek krijgt in huis, bij voorkeur centraal, zodat het signaal overal goed is.
Installeer eerst een besturingssysteem op je Pi. Raspberry Pi OS is de meest voor de hand liggende keuze.
Daarna installeer je Docker, een programma dat apps makkelijk beheert. Met Docker draai je Zigbee2MQTT en Home Assistant (of een andere hub) in aparte ‘containers’, wat het overzichtelijk houdt. Volg de stappen op de Zigbee2MQTT-website: je configureert je coordinator, start de software en leert bijvoorbeeld hoe je een Tado koppelt door deze in de ‘pairing’-modus te zetten. Zodra je thermostaat is toegevoegd, zie je alle data in een overzichtelijk dashboard.
Je kunt de temperatuur uitlezen, de gewenste stand instellen en de status van je cv-ketel of warmtepomp monitoren. Via MQTT kun je commando’s sturen, bijvoorbeeld ‘verwarm naar 21 graden’ of ‘schakel over op eco-modus’.
Varianten en modellen: wat kies je?
Er zijn verschillende thermostaten die goed werken met Zigbee2MQTT. De Aqara Smart Thermostat (€80-€90) is populair en wordt vaak gezien als de beste Zigbee thermostaat voor Home Assistant vanwege zijn strakke design.
Hij werkt met radiatorventilatoren en cv-ketels en is eenvoudig te koppelen. Benieuwd hoe je een slimme thermostaat koppelt aan je centrale hub? Voor wie meer functionaliteit wil, is de Tuya Zigbee Thermostat (€40-€60) een goede optie.
Deze heeft vaak een kleiner scherm maar biedt meer instelmogelijkheden, zoals weekprogramma’s en kinderbeveiliging. Wil je echt low-budget? Kijk naar de Moes House Zigbee Thermostat (€35-€45).
Hij doet wat hij moet doen en is compatibel met de meeste radiatorknoppen. Voor wie een warmtepomp heeft, is de Honeywell T6 Zigbee (€120-€150) een uitstekende keuze.
Deze ondersteunt namelijk ook het aansturen van een warmtepomp en is zeer nauwkeurig. Qua coordinators is de Sonoff Zigbee 3.0 USB Dongle Plus de meest betrouwbare keuze voor de meeste huishoudens. De ConBee II is iets duurder maar biedt meer ondersteuning voor complexere netwerken. Beide zijn verkrijgbaar bij webshops zoals AliExpress, Bol.com of Conrad.
Praktische tips voor een soepele installatie
Plaats je coordinator op een verlengkabel, zodat je hem op een centrale plek kunt positioneren. Vermijd USB-hubs zonder externe voeding, want die kunnen storing geven.
Test je Zigbee-netwerk voordat je je thermostaat toevoegt. Zorg dat je minstens drie Zigbee-apparaten hebt (bijvoorbeeld een paar slimme lampen of sensoren) om een stabiel mesh-netwerk te bouwen. Koppel je thermostaat aan je energiemanagement.
Gebruik Home Assistant of een vergelijkbaar platform om regels te bouwen die rekening houden met je zonnepanelen en laadpaal.
Bijvoorbeeld: als de zon volop schijnt en je laadpaal actief is, verlaag je de verwarming met 1 graad. Of: als de stroomprijs onder de 20 cent per kWh zakt, verwarm je de woonkamer naar 22 graden. Houd rekening met de batterijduur van je thermostaat.
De meeste modellen gaan 1-2 jaar mee op één set batterijen. Vervang ze op tijd om storingen te voorkomen.
En tot slot: experimenteer rustig. Begin met een eenvoudige regel en breid langzaam uit.
Zo leer je het systeem kennen en voorkom je dat je overweldigd raakt.
